You’ll find this information printed directly on your tire's sidewall. Look for a sequence like P215/65R16. The '215' is the tire's width in millimeters, '65' is the aspect ratio (sidewall height as a percentage of width), and 'R16' indicates the rim diameter in inches. This trio of numbers forms the basis for most tire chain size charts.
Why Correct Sizing Matters
Using chains that are too large can lead to them falling off while driving, potentially causing significant damage to your vehicle's body, brakes, or suspension components. Conversely, chains that are too small may not fit at all or will be extremely difficult to install, offering compromised coverage and less effective traction. How to Read and Use a Tire Chain Size Chart
How do you find the specific chain that matches your tires? Tire chain size charts are designed to be straightforward, typically presenting tire dimensions in a clear, comparative format. When you encounter a chart, you'll usually see columns for tire width, aspect ratio, and rim diameter, directly corresponding to the numbers on your tire's sidewall.
Decoding the Chart
Locate your tire's width (e.g., 215mm), aspect ratio (e.g., 65), and rim diameter (e.g., 16 inches). Scan the chart to find the row or section that precisely matches all three of your tire's specifications. The chart will then indicate the corresponding tire chain size or part number you need.
Some charts may also account for specific tire types or vehicle classes. For instance, charts for heavy duty truck tire chains will look different from those for passenger vehicles, often dealing with larger, more robust tire sizes and chain designs like heavy duty truck tire chains.
Always double-check the chart for specific notes regarding clearance, especially for vehicles with limited fender space or low-profile tires.

Off-Road and Industrial Equipment
When looking at tire chains for skid steer loaders or other industrial equipment, the sizing can be less standardized. Skid loader tire chains or tire chains for skid steer loaders are often referred to by specific equipment model numbers or unique tire dimensions that might not follow standard P-metric or LT-metric formats. Referencing the equipment manual or the tire manufacturer's recommendations is vital here. Some skid steer tire chain setups are designed for specific tread patterns or operating conditions.
For skid steer loaders, measure the actual installed tire dimensions if a chart is unavailable, as 'stock' sizes can vary significantly.

Low Clearance Vehicles
Vehicles with limited wheel well space, often found in modern sedans or performance cars, demand low-profile or specialized tire chains. These might be cable chains or European-style low-clearance chains. Standard charts may not adequately cover these, so seeking out chains specifically marketed for low-clearance applications is key.
